Output abf65b2e86ddf1ed463f6a123e020c49d0679cf00b8d085b9d75f895642c445a:3

value
30738462
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83d8b03ef5e99c59062c1afef05718bdbc6e0041 OP_EQUALVERIFY OP_CHECKSIG
address
1D296ufSpBFFn2UbLL87dz2iWq2VBAjEaa
transaction
abf65b2e86ddf1ed463f6a123e020c49d0679cf00b8d085b9d75f895642c445a
spent
true